  •   Epiphyllum anguliger, also called Ric Rac Cactus, is an epiphytic cactus native to the tropical forests of Mexico, where it anchors itself to trees rather than growing in soil. This cactus grows well in the warm, humid conditions that mimic its forest-canopy origins, making it accessible to beginners in homes and offices.

      The plant has deeply notched, flat stems that zigzag in a bold fishbone pattern. The stems are green and fleshy, growing quite long and arching outward and downward in a trailing habit that looks striking in a hanging basket or displayed on a high shelf.

      Epiphyllum anguliger is a night-blooming cactus that produces large, fragrant white to pale yellow flowers opening after dark, typically in autumn. Encouraging blooms requires a night temperature drop in late summer to signal the plant to set buds.

      It is non-toxic to cats and dogs, so it can be displayed freely in pet-friendly homes. The plant releases oxygen at night, making it a useful bedroom companion, and it grows well near kitchen moisture where humidity naturally stays higher. Propagation is straightforward: cut a healthy stem segment, let the cut end callous for 24-48 hours, then place it in moist well-draining soil to root.

  •   Ric Rac Cactus Fire (Epiphyllum anguliger) grows well in bright indirect light and scorches in direct south-facing sun.

      Water it every 10-14 days during spring and summer, reducing to once monthly in winter.

      Epiphyllum anguliger does best in a well-draining mix of standard potting soil blended with orchid bark and perlite.

      It prefers temperatures between 60-85°F and must be protected from frost and temperatures below 50°F.

      Epiphyllum anguliger is a moderate grower that benefits from balanced liquid fertilizer applied monthly during spring and summer.

      It is hardy in USDA zones 10-12 and tolerates temperatures no lower than 30-35°F before frost damage occurs. It grows outdoors year-round in Hawaii, southern Florida, southern California, and the southernmost tips of Texas and Arizona. It can spend summers outdoors in Louisiana, Georgia, South Carolina, Alabama, Mississippi, Nevada, and coastal Oregon if moved indoors before autumn temperatures drop.
  • Q: Is Ric Rac Cactus Fire (Epiphyllum anguliger) safe for pets?
    A: It is non-toxic to cats and dogs and can be displayed anywhere in a pet-friendly home.

    Q: What happens if I place it in direct sun?
    A: Ric Rac Cactus Fire (Epiphyllum anguliger) scorches in south-facing direct sunlight; the stems develop pale or bleached patches that cannot recover.

    Q: How do I propagate Epiphyllum anguliger?
    A: Cut a healthy stem segment, allow the cut end to callous for 24-48 hours, then place it in moist well-draining soil to root.

    Q: Can it go outside in summer?
    A: It loves spending summer outdoors in a sheltered spot with bright indirect light, but bring it in before temperatures cool below 50°F. Epiphyllum anguliger resumes growth faster when moved back indoors before the cold snap.

    Q: Why are the stems on Ric Rac Cactus turning yellow?
    A: Yellowing is most often caused by overwatering, low humidity, or exposure to cold air from AC or heating vents.

    Q: Does it need a hanging basket?
    A: Ric Rac Cactus has a trailing growth style that works well in a hanging basket or on a high shelf, where the long zigzag stems can extend naturally.
